Notre Dame - Pittsburgh preview and analysis


Recent form
Notre Dame: won 83-73 vs. Texas A&M-Corpus Christi on Dec. 22
Pittsburgh: won 64-55 vs. Jacksonville on Dec. 21

It’s the ACC home opener for the Pittsburgh Panthers when they face the Notre Dame Fighting Irish on Tuesday, and it’s a game both programs could use to build some momentum before the bulk of conference play.

Both teams are 0-1 in ACC play but it was even more of an underwhelming non-conference slate for the Panthers and Fighting Irish. Things have picked up as of late with the Panthers winning three of four after losing four straight, and Notre Dame also on a three-wins-in-four-games run after losing the previous three.

The Irish are coming off an 83-73 win over Texas A&M-Corpus Christi in which they made 16 3-pointers and survived a tough test from the Islanders. Notre Dame leading scorer Dane Goodwin had a season-high 21 points while making five of those 16 threes to help take down the leaders of the Southland Conference.

Goodwin has hit double figures in every game this season; the sharpshooter is averaging 15.6 per game over his last five starts and has made nine threes in his last two games. He had 18 points in 24 minutes on Dec. 20 against Western Michigan. The senior guard became the 66th Notre Dame player ever to reach 1,000 points and was named the ACC Co-Player of the Week on Monday.

The other Player of the Week? He’s playing against him Tuesday.

Pittsburgh sophomore guard Femi Odukale scored a career-high 28 points in the Panthers’ 64-55 win against Jacksonville on Dec. 21. It was the sixth double-digit scoring game for Odukale this season, who is second on Pitt with 12.4 points and 3.4 assists per game.

The Panthers have held five of their past six opponents to fewer than 60 points, allowing 57.8 points per game in that span. Mouhamadou Gueye had 15 points and 12 rebounds for Pitt.

Prediction


The Panthers are 3-5 all-time in ACC home openers under head coach Jeff Capel, but more importantly, Notre Dame has won five of the last six meetings. It may not be the marquee matchup in the ACC, but Notre Dame is still a talented group that should win this game comfortably. Notre Dame by 10

Betting trends


Notre Dame is 2-8 ATS this season and 28-38 over the past three seasons.

Notre Dame is 6-17 ATS in its last 23 following a non-conference game.

Pittsburgh is 7-5 ATS in its last 12 as a home dog.
